There will be no classes at this event. ALL pilots will be competing on the same level and ALL results will be posted to the MultiGP GLOBAL Leader-board!
Standard MultiGP racing rules apply. 2min heats. Top 3 consecutive qualifying format. Qualifying heats ALL DAY. No mains.
Bring tents, tables, chairs, and anything else you need to bring to stay comfortable outdoors for 8+ hours. Power is available around the parking area. Generators are allowed. Restrooms will be in the BARN, just a short walk from the field! Spectating is FREE and is always welcomed. If you have any questions, feel free to reach out to any of the KCMR officers!
Please consider committing to come early for Set-Up or plan to stay after the race for Tear-Down. Its A LOT of work and we can't do this without you guys!

Race Specifications/Classes: OPEN CLASS
Max Charge of 4.35v per cell
800g AUW Max Weight
25mw Max
All pilots MUST provide their name, pilot handle, admission fees and AMA status info. We randomly require pilots to pass a props-off tech inspection during check-in. This process will be carried out by the race director before the race begins.
Pilots who have an "Active" AMA membership, as well as pilots who compete nationally, will typically be exempt from tech inspections. These pilots should request power level or channel checks at their own necessity.
Other pilots may be required to demonstrate that their drones are transmitting on the proper channel and at the correct power level. We also check pilots for proper failsafe settings. (If you turn off your transmitter during flight, your drone should turn off as well) KCMR requires pilots to remove all props during this inspection, for safety.
MultiGP requires ALL pilots to obtain an active AMA membership for insurance purposes to enter races. KCMR strongly recommends that our pilots follow suit at our home race, however, this membership is not required.
We will be using RACEBAND and FATSHARK channels for this event. The frequencies being used are as follows:
R1 - 5658
R2 - 5695
F2 - 5760
F4 - 5800
R7 - 5880
R8 - 5917
DJI (digital) pilots should plan to fly on DJI 6 and DJI 7. Despite what MultiGP will assign you, this will be resolved during Check-In
We require all VTXs to be Raceband and FatShark compliant. All VTX's will be required to run at 25mW. Please come prepared to change your VTX and/or the channel/band of your VTX as needed for each race. All channels will be verified during Check-In.
We require all drones remain on the assigned frequency during the entire event. All drones must remain unplugged in the pits unless approved by a KCMR officer. SAFETY FIRST! Assume MultiGP assigned channels are accurate, but frequencies are subject to change at a moment's notice. Let a KCMR officer know if you must change your channel mid-event.
